The well-known comics company Marvel offers due to coronavirus, free access to its popular comics until May 4.
Marvel is famous for a wide range of fictional comic book heroes. Helping her fans overcome the coronavirus pandemic and forced isolation in their homes, she has several popular comic book titles for free for a month.
Access to Marvel Unlimited free comics is through the company's mobile applications. Specifically, from April 2 to May 4 you will be able to read the following comic titles:
- Avengers Vs. X-Men
- Civil War
- Amazing Spider-Man: Red Goblin
- Black Panther by Ta-Nehisi Coates Vol. 1
- Thanos Wins by Donny Cates
- X-Men Milestones: Dark Phoenix Saga
- Avengers: Kree / Skrull War
- Avengers by Jason Aaron Vol. 1: The Final Host
- Fantastic Four Vol. 1: Fourever
- Black Widow Vol. 1: SHIELD'S Most Wanted
- Captain America: Winter Soldier Ultimate
- Captain Marvel Vol. 1: Higher, Further, Faster, More
